Kredete, a Nigerian fintech startup, has officially launched its AI-powered lending platform, aimed at providing access to formal credit, financial literacy, and innovative financial solutions. This development marks a significant milestone in Nigeria’s financial landscape, as the country strives to bridge the significant credit gap and financial exclusion faced by millions of Nigerians who lack access to formal credit through traditional means.
At the launch event, held at the Civic Centre in Victoria Island, tech specialists, and entrepreneurs gathered to discuss the future of lending in Africa and Kredete’s commitment to transforming the financial landscape by leveraging technology. The platform utilizes AI-powered algorithms to analyze creditworthiness, enabling it to make quick and accurate lending decisions.
Kredete’s innovative approach to lending aims to provide underserved populations with access to credit, empowering them to build businesses, create employment opportunities, and drive economic growth. The platform offers affordable interest rates, flexible repayment terms, and personalized loan offers, tailored to each customer’s unique needs and circumstances.
Kredete’s focus on financial literacy is another key aspect of its mission, as the platform aims to educate its customers on financial management, responsible borrowing, and credit building. By promoting financial literacy, Kredete hopes to empower its customers to make informed financial decisions, improve their credit scores, and access more credit in the future.
